Are there any Motown songs from the 1950's?

Yes, Though question is rough. The Tamla label started in Jan 1959 and the Motown label started in Sep 1959 12 songs were recorded on Tamla with "MONEY" being the most popular (also released nationally on ANNA label) Anna Gordy was Berry Gordy's sister. 1 song was released on the Motown label "Bad Girl" G-1 by "The Miracles" this title was transferred from the Tamla label TLX2207 that had a strange numbering convention and the only recording starting with TLX series. Both recorded/released SEP 1959.
